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

What is the best jacket material for fiber cables installed in Manila? +
For indoor use in Manila's commercial buildings, LSZH (Low Smoke Zero Halogen) is recommended due to strict fire safety regulations. For outdoor/underground distribution, PE or Double-Jacketed cables provide the best protection against humidity and water ingress.
